Here is a list of some of the greatest indian women scientists of all time. 1. janaki ammal was a renowned indian botanist and plant cytologist. she was the first woman to obtain a ph.d. in botany in the united states from the university of michigan in 1931. she was born on 4th nov 1897 in thalassery, kerala.

Renowned indian microbiologist gagandeep kang created history in 2019 when she became the first female indian elected to the rank of member of the royal society. her ground breaking work focuses on child viral diseases, namely rotaviral vaccine trials.
